It is important to understand how the Home Star Energy program works and the mechanics of the same. The Silver Star program is known as a conservative rebate program. Here the homeowners would qualify for the rebates if they purchase boilers, windows and the like for home improvements. The homeowners would get a rebate up to 50 percent on these products. There is higher limit set up to which the homeowners can avail rebates under the Silver Star program. This limit is $3000.

The Gold Home Star Energy program is beautifully designed. This is the main concentration area and Home Star is now encouraging as many homeowners as possible to get a Gold Star rebate. The homeowners would get a rebate anywhere between $1000 and $8000 if they can show that there has been a reduction in the energy utilization. The contractors and home auditors will closely monitor such results and confirm the same to the Department of Energy.

Depending upon the accuracy of the results, the department will grant the rebates to the homeowners. The department of Home Energy is trying to accelerate the number in the total number of weatherization projects. There is news that the Government had already set aside $6billion towards financing the rebates. They are trying to drive energy efficiency through these rebates.
